Roundtable: Get Your Priorities Straight

We’re all guilty of procrastination, wasting time, and over-cluttering our schedules. As adults, we know we should do better, but where do we start? How can we prioritize our lives to make time for what’s really important? Our guests share their own struggles and strategies for how to find time for God, family, friendships and responsibilities, while also making space for rest and fun.

Culture: Know Your Future In-Laws

A relationship with your in-laws can be wonderful, or it can be difficult and even complicated. Finding an appropriate relational balance is tricky, as is establishing boundaries and closeness. Most of these efforts start during dating and engagement, so what does it look like to pursue a healthy relationship on the in-law front? Relationship experts Dr. Greg and Erin Smalley explain how they navigated in-law relationships, what challenges they experienced, how they had hard conversations, and what loving an extended family looks like.
